区块链的基本概念
区块链是一种分布式账本技术,它能够以去中心化的方式记录和存储数据。数据被分为多个区块,每个区块内包含时间戳及前一个区块的哈希值,从而形成一条链。每个节点都可以查看完整的账本内容,这使得数据不可篡改,增强了安全性和透明度。
最早的区块链应用是比特币,这是一种数字货币,由一名化名为中本聪的程序员于2009年推出。比特币的出现让人们首次看到了区块链技术的潜力,因为它不仅能够实现交易的去中心化,还确保了交易的安全和隐私。
区块链的工作原理

区块链的工作原理基于分布式网络和密码学技术。每当进行一笔交易时,交易信息会被发送到网络中的所有节点。节点会对交易进行验证,并通过共识算法(例如工作量证明、权益证明等)达成一致。交易信息在被确认后会打包成一个区块,并与前一个区块链接在一起,形成链条。
每个区块包含几个主要部分:交易数据、时间戳和上一个区块的哈希值。由于哈希算法的单向性和抗篡改性,任何对区块中数据的更改都会导致哈希值发生变化,从而打破链条的完整性。这种结构确保了区块链的不可篡改性和安全性。
区块链的特点
区块链具有以下几大特点:
- 去中心化:在区块链网络中,没有单一的管理者,数据由所有节点共同维护。这种结构降低了单点故障的风险。
- 透明性:区块链上的所有交易对任何人可见,确保了系统的透明性。
- 不可篡改性:一旦信息被记录在区块链上,几乎不可能被修改或删除,增强了数据的安全性。
- 高安全性:通过使用技术手段如密码学,区块链确保了数据传输和存储过程中对于隐私的保护。
- 智能合约:区块链支持智能合约的功能,能够自动执行合约条款,减少人为干预,提高效率。
区块链的应用领域

区块链技术的应用领域非常广泛,涵盖金融、供应链、医疗、身份验证、投票、房地产等多个行业。
在金融领域,区块链技术被广泛用于数字货币的交易以及跨境支付。其高速、安全的特点使得跨境资金流动更加便捷。
在供应链管理中,区块链能够实现从生产、运输到销售的全流程追踪,确保产品的真实性和来源,防止伪造和欺诈行为。
医疗行业中,区块链可以用于患者信息的管理和共享,确保数据的安全和隐私,同时便于医疗服务的提供。
身份验证是区块链的重要应用之一,能够实现去中心化的身份身份认证,提升用户隐私保护的同时,减少身份盗用的风险。
区块链面临的挑战
尽管区块链技术具有很多优势,但也面临着一些挑战:
- 扩展性问题:随着用户数量的增加,处理大量交易的能力受到限制,可能导致网络拥堵。
- 能源消耗:一些共识算法需要大量的计算资源,导致能源消耗过高,引发环境问题。
- 法律和监管问题:区块链的去中心化特性使得法律与监管保护面临困难,各国政府对此的监管政策也各不相同。
- 技术的复杂性:区块链的使用需要一定的技术门槛,普通用户可能难以理解和使用。
常见问题解答
区块链与比特币有什么区别?
许多人在谈及区块链时,往往首先想到比特币。实际上,二者并不是完全等价的概念。比特币是利用区块链技术实现的一种数字货币,而区块链则是支持比特币及其他许多数字货币和应用的一种底层技术。
比特币是实施区块链技术的第一个应用,采用的是公开、透明的记账方式,使每一个比特币的交易都能在全球范围内被验证。通过这种去中心化的方式,比特币确保了交易的安全性和匿名性。
而<>区块链>则更为广泛,除了数字货币外,还可以应用于其他领域。区块链可以服务于智能合约、数字身份、供应链管理等,为不同行业带来创新。因此,区块链并不仅仅局限于比特币,而是一个更广泛的技术框架。
什么是智能合约,如何应用于区块链?
智能合约是一个可以在区块链上自动执行合约条款的计算机程序。它的出现使得合约执行变得更加高效和安全。传统的合约需要依赖中介机构进行验证和执行,而智能合约通过编程代码来自动运作,降低了人力成本和错误风险。
智能合约的应用非常广泛。例如,在房地产交易中,双方可以用智能合约确保交易的透明性与安全性,通过区块链记录所有交易信息,保证每一个环节的可追溯性。而在金融领域,智能合约被用于自动处理贷款或证券交易,使得交易过程快捷且高效。
智能合约的优势在于其不可篡改性与全自动执行特性,确保了双方的合约执行不会被随意干扰。同时,由于在区块链上进行操作,因此每个契约都具有高度的透明性。这种软件协议不仅提高了交易的速度,还降低了交易的复杂度,受到了各个行业的青睐。
如何确保区块链技术的安全性?
区块链以其独特的分布式特性和密码学技术确保了其安全性。首先,区块链的每个节点都保存完整的账本,不依赖于单一的数据存储点,这大大降低了数据被篡改的风险。
其次,区块链采用哈希算法、数字签名等密码技术,确保了数据在传输和存储过程中的安全。每一个区块包含前一个区块的哈希值,这样即使某个节点被攻破,篡改数据也会导致链条完整性的破坏,从而可以通过其他链上的节点发现问题并采取相应措施。
此外,不同的区块链网络还可以选择使用多种共识机制(例如工作量证明、权益证明等),进行交易审计与验证,确保数据的真实性。同时,经过审计验证的交易将是不可篡改的,进一步增强了区块链的安全性。
区块链技术对现有行业的影响有哪些?
区块链技术对许多行业产生了深远的影响。首先,在金融服务领域,区块链改变了传统的支付与结算方式,使得跨境支付更为快捷、成本更低,尤其对那些没有银行账户的人群尤为重要。
其次,在供应链管理中,区块链技术能够实现产品从源头到消费者的全过程追踪。通过在区块链上记录产品信息,消费者能够清楚了解产品来源,这有助于打击假冒伪劣产品,增强消费者信任。
医疗行业也是受到区块链影响的领域之一,通过共享患者医疗记录,促进了数据的透明性,缩短了治疗时间,提升了医疗服务质量。此外,法律行业也可以利用区块链技术进行电子证据以及合同的存证,提高了合同执行的安全性。
总之,区块链技术正在重塑多个行业的运作模式,提升效率,确保安全,未来可能带来更多创新与变革。
区块链发展的未来趋势如何?
随着技术的不断进步与发展,区块链的未来趋势也逐渐清晰。首先,越来越多的行业将会采用区块链技术去解决自身的问题。如金融、医疗、物流、房地产等领域,区块链的应用前景广阔,潜在市场巨大。
其次,区块链的技术升级也在进行中,不同的共识机制、混合链技术的出现,将提升区块链在安全性、效率和可升级性方面的表现。此外,绿色区块链也成为了未来的研究方向,旨在减小区块链网络的能耗。
最后,区块链技术的标准化和法律法规的完善也非常重要,只有在监管体系内合理推进,才能实现区块链技术的长远发展,解决发展过程中所带来的问题与挑战。区块链未来的演变将依然充满机遇与挑战,但可预见的是,其应用将愈发广泛,对社会生活、经济发展产生深远影响。
以上是对区块链的全面解析,涵盖了其基本概念、工作原理、特点、应用领域、面临的挑战及常见问题,希望为读者提供有价值的信息与参考。